Effects 🌎

Add dynamic elements to the 3D scene to allow the scene to move and run more closely to the real world

DC.Weather

example

let weather = new DC.Weather(viewer)

creation

  • constructor()

    • Returns weather

properties

Rain

example

viewer.weather.rain.enable = true
viewer.weather.rain.speed = 2

properties

  • {Boolean} enable
  • {Number} speed

Snow

example

viewer.weather.snow.enable = true
viewer.weather.snow.speed = 2

properties

  • {Boolean} enable
  • {Number} speed

Fog

example

viewer.weather.fog.enable = true
viewer.weather.fog.fogColor = DC.Color.BLACK

properties

  • {Boolean} enable
  • `{Color} fogColor
  • {Object} fogByDistance: { near: 10, nearValue: 0, far: 2000, farValue: 1.0 }

Cloud

example

viewer.weather.cloud.enable = true
viewer.weather.cloud.rotateAmount = 0.02

properties

  • {Boolean} enable
  • {Number} rotateAmount

DC.Effect

example

let effect = new DC.Effect()
viewer.use(effect)

creation

  • constructor()

    • Returns effect

properties

BlackAndWhite

example

viewer.effect.blackAndWhite.enable = true

properties

  • {Boolean} enable
  • {Number} gradations
  • {Array} selected

Bloom

example

viewer.effect.bloom.enable = true

properties

  • {Boolean} enable
  • {Number} contrast
  • {Number} brightness
  • {Number} glowOnly
  • {Number} delta
  • {Number} sigma
  • {Number} stepSize
  • {Array} selected

Brightness

example

viewer.effect.brightness.enable = true

properties

  • {Boolean} enable
  • {Number} intensity
  • {Array} selected

DepthOfField

example

viewer.effect.depthOfField.enable = true

properties

  • {Boolean} enable
  • {Number}} focalDistance
  • {Number} delta
  • {Number} sigma
  • {Number} stepSize
  • {Array} selected

LensFlare

example

viewer.effect.lensFlare.enable = true

properties

  • {Boolean} enable
  • {Number}} intensity
  • {Number} distortion
  • {Number} dirtAmount
  • {Number} haloWidth
  • {Array} selected

Night

example

viewer.effect.night.enable = true

properties

  • {Boolean} enable
  • {Array} selected

Silhouette

example

viewer.effect.silhouette.enable = true

properties

  • {Boolean} enable
  • {Color} color
  • {Number} length
  • {Array} selected

Animation

Animation base class

:::warning The class cannot be instantiated :::

methods

  • start()

    • returns this
  • stop()

    • returns this

DC.AroundPoint

Inherited from Animation

example

let aroundPoint = new DC.AroundPoint(viewer, '120.121, 31.12')
aroundPoint.start()

creation

  • constructor(viewer,position,[options])

    • parameters
    • {Viewer} viewer
    • {Position|String|Array} position
    • {Object} options
    • returns aroundPoint
//options(optional)
{
  "heading": 0,
  "pitch": 0,
  "range": 0,
  "duration": 0,
  "callback": null,
  "context": null
}

DC.AroundView

Inherited from Animation

example

let aroundView = new DC.AroundView(viewer)
aroundView.start()

creation

  • constructor(viewer,options)

    • parameters
    • {Viewer} viewer
    • {Object} options
    • returns aroundView
//options(optional)
{
  "heading": 0,
  "duration": 0,
  "pitch": 0,
  "roll": 0,
  "callback": null,
  "context": null
}

DC.CircleScan

Inherited from Animation

example

let circleScan = new DC.CircleScan(viewer, '120, 20', 200)
circleScan.start()

creation

  • constructor(viewer,position,radius,[options])

    • parameters
    • {Viewer} viewer:场景
    • {DC.Position} position:位置
    • {Number} radius:半径
    • {Object} options:属性
    • returns circleScan
//options(optional)
{
  "color": DC.Color.BLUE,
  "speed": 5
}

DC.Flying

Inherited from Animation

example

let flying = new DC.Flying(viewer)
flying.positions = ['121.234,21.212,0,-29', '121.435,21.212,0,-29']
flying.start()

creation

  • constructor(viewer,options)

    • parameters
    • {Viewer} viewer:场景
    • {Object} options:options
    • returns flying
//options(optional)
{
  "loop": false,
  "dwellTime": 3,
  "callback": null
}

properties

  • {Array} positions
  • {Array} durations: The flight interval of each point, when the length of the array is 1, each interval is the same, if not 1, the length must be equal to the length of the point

methods

  • start()

    • returns this
  • pause()

    • returns this
  • restore()

    • returns this

DC.GlobeRotate

Inherited from Animation

example

let globeRotate = new DC.GlobeRotate(viewer, {
  duration: 5,
  speed: 1000,
  callback: () => {},
})
globeRotate.start()

creation

  • constructor(viewer,[options])

    • parameters
    • {DC.Viewer} viewer
    • {Object} options
    • returns globeRotate
//options(optional)
{
  "speed": 12 * 1000,
  "duration": 0,
  "callback": null,
  "context": null
}

DC.RadarScan

Inherited from Animation

example

let radarScan = new DC.RadarScan(viewer, '120, 20', 200)
radarScan.start()

creation

  • constructor(viewer,position,radius,options)

    • parameters
    • {Viewer} viewer
    • {DC.Position} position
    • {Number} radius
    • {Object} options
    • returns radarScan
//options(optional)
{
  "color": DC.Color.BLUE,
  "speed": 5
}

DC.RoamingController

example

let rc = new DC.RoamingController(viewer)

creation

  • constructor(viewer)

    • parameters
    • {Viewer} viewer
    • returns roamingController

methods

  • addPath(path)

    • parameters
    • {RoamingPath} path
    • returns this
  • addPaths(paths)

    • parameters
    • {Array<RoamingPath>} paths
    • returns this
  • removePath(path)

    • parameters
    • {RoamingPath} path
    • returns path
  • getPath(id)

    • parameters
    • {String} id
    • returns path
  • getPaths()

    • returns array
  • activate(path, viewOption)

    • parameters
    • {RoamingPath} path
    • {String} viewOption
    • returns this
// options (optional)
{
  "pitch": 0,
  "range": 1000
}
  • deactivate()

    • returns this
  • clear()

    • returns this

DC.RoamingPath

example

let path = new DC.RoamingPath('120.121,32.1213;121.132,32.1213', 20)
rc.addPath(path)

creation

  • constructor(positions, duration, [pathMode])

    • parameters
    • {String|Array<Position|Number|String|Object>} positions
    • {Number} duration
    • {String} pathMode speed / time
    • returns roamingPath

properties

  • {String} pathId readonly
  • {String} id
  • {String|Array<Position|Number|String>} positions
  • {Number} duration
  • {String} pathMode speed / time
  • {String} state readonly

DC.KeyboardRoaming

example

let kr = new DC.KeyboardRoaming(viewer)
kr.enable = true

creation

  • constructor(viewer)

    • parameters
    • {Viewer} viewer
    • returns keyboardRoaming

properties

  • {Boolean} enable
  • {Number} moveRate default: 100
  • {Number} rotateRate default: 0.01

DC.TrackController

example

let tc = new DC.TrackController(viewer)

creation

  • constructor(viewer)

    • parameters
    • {Viewer} viewer
    • returns trackController

methods

  • addTrack(track)

    • parameters
    • {Track} track
    • returns this
  • addTracks(tracks)

    • parameters
    • {Array<Track>} tracks
    • returns this
  • removeTrack(track)

    • parameters
    • {Track} track
    • returns path
  • getTrack(id)

    • parameters
    • {String} id
    • returns track
  • getTracks()

    • returns array
  • play()

    • returns this
  • pause()

    • returns this
  • restore()

    • returns this
  • viewTrack(track, viewOption)

    • parameters
    • {Track} track
    • {String} viewOption
    • returns this
// options (optional)
{
  "mode": null, // DC.TrackViewMode
  "pitch": 0,
  "range": 1000
}
  • releaseTrack(track)

    • parameters
    • {Track} track:路径
    • returns this
  • clear()

    • returns this

DC.Track

example

let track = new DC.Track('120.121,32.1213;121.132,32.1213', 20)
rc.addTrack(track)

creation

  • constructor(positions, duration, [callback], [options])

    • parameters
    • {String|Array<Position|Number|String|Object>} positions
    • {Number} duration
    • {Function} callback:Each point arrival callback function, parameters are: position, isLast
    • {Object} options
    • returns track
// options (optional)
{
  "clampToGround": false,
  "clampToTileset": false,
  "interpolationType": "Linear", // Linear、Hermite、Lagrange
  "interpolationDegree": 2,
  "endDelayTime": 0.5 // End time extension time, unit:second
}

properties

  • {String} trackId readonly
  • {String} id
  • {String|Array<Position|Number|String|Object>} positions
  • {Number} duration
  • {Date} startTime
  • {String} state readonly

methods

  • addPosition(position,duration)

    • parameters
    • {Position|Array|String|Object} position
    • {Number} duration
    • returns this
  • setModel(modelUrl,style)

    • parameters
    • {String} modelPath
    • {Object} style DC.Model
    • returns this
  • setBillboard(icon,style)

    • parameters
    • {String} icon
    • {Object} style DC.Billboard
    • returns this
  • setLabel(text,style)

    • parameters
    • {String} text
    • {Object} style DC.Label
    • returns this
  • setPath(visible,style)

    • parameters
    • {Boolean}} visible
    • {Object} style DC.Polyline
    • returns this
